September 26, 2025
Edmonton, Alberta, Canada – Edmonton Expo Centre
Commentary – Tom Hannifan and Matthew Rehwoldt
Results via TNAWrestling.com
Quick Match Results
- Countdown to Victory Road Pre-show: Three-way match – Zachary Wentz defeated Cedric Alexander and Trey Miguel via UFO Cutter (pinfall)
- Six-Man Tag Team match – The System defeated Order 4 via Down & Dirty (pinfall)
- Vacant TNA Knockouts World Championship Contenders Battle Royal match – Lei Ying Lee and Kelani Jordan won via last eliminating The IInspiration and The Elegance Brand
- The Home Town Man & Matt Cardona defeated The Nemeths via Roll-up (pinfall)
- Mike Santana defeated Ridge Holland via Spin The Block (pinfall)
- Winner Gets Team Advantage in Hardcore War Match at Bound For Glory – Mustafa Ali defeated Moose via 450 Splash (pinfall)
- Joe Hendry defeated Eric Young via Standing Ovation (pinfall)
- Tables match – Matt Hardy defeated AJ Francis via putting Francis through table
- Vacant TNA Knockouts World Championship Special Guest Referee match – Kelani Jordan defeated Lei Ying Lee via Split-Legged Moonsault (pinfall)
- TNA International Championship – Frankie Kazarian defeated Steve Maclin (c) via Slingshot Cutter (pinfall)
- TNA X-Division Championship – Leon Slater (c) defeated Myron Reed via Swanton 450 (pinfall)

TNA President Carlos Silva and Director of Authority Santino Marella are in the ring as Knockouts World Champion Ash By Elegance makes a special announcement. Ash is emotional as she reveals that she is no longer able to compete. Ash announces that she is stepping away from in-ring competition and reluctantly forfeits the Knockouts World Title.
Vacant TNA Knockouts World Championship Contenders Battle Royal Match
Kelani Jordan vs. Lei Ying Lee vs. Xia Brookside vs. Dani Luna vs. Cassie Lee vs. Jessie McKay vs. Jody Threat vs. Maggie Lee vs. Heather By Elegance
The TNA Knockouts World Tag Team Title match between The IInspiration and The Elegance Brand will now take place this Thursday on iMPACT. Right now, there will be a Battle Royal where the final two Knockouts will compete in a match later tonight to crown the new Knockouts World Champion.
The field includes NXT’s Kelani Jordan, Léi Yǐng Lee, Xia Brookside, Dani Luna, Cassie Lee, Jessie McKay, Jody Threat, Maggie Lee and Heather By Elegance. It comes down to Kelani Jordan and Léi Yǐng Lee, who will now face each other later tonight for the vacant Knockouts World Title, with Indi Hartwell as Special Guest Referee!
Winner: Kelani Jordan and Lei Ying Lee.

Winner Gets Team Advantage in Hardcore War Match at Bound For Glory
Moose vs. Mustafa Ali
WHAT JUST HAPPENED!? @MustafaAli_X @TheMooseNation
— TNA Wrestling (@ThisIsTNA) September 27, 2025
WATCH #TNAVictoryRoad on TNA+: https://t.co/QtSUgdUYkS
Use code VICTORY25 for one free month of TNA+: https://t.co/d4BBN0TwN2 pic.twitter.com/Qn6zauHLqj
Moose battles Mustafa Ali with the Hardcore War numbers advantage at Bound For Glory up for grabs! The System and Order 4 are banned from ringside. Ali dives through the ropes, sending Moose crashing into the steel guardrail. Ali counters a powerbomb attempt into a Canadian Destroyer for two. Ali goes for a springboard but Moose counters into Go To Hell for a near fall of his own. Moose hits a Spear from out of nowhere but Ali gets his foot on the bottom rope. Ali hits a back body drop as Moose collides with the steel ring steps. Ali hits the 450 but Moose stands up. Ali’s dancers get up on the apron to distract the referee. Tasha Steelz is disguised as one of the dancers as she delivers a low blow to Moose. Ali capitalizes with another 450 to win.
Winner: Mustafa Ali via Pinfall.

Vacant TNA Knockouts World Championship Special Guest Referee Match
Kelani Jordan vs. Lei Ying Lee
.@TheLeiYingLee just hit @kelani_wwe with a top rope Hurricanrana!
— TNA Wrestling (@ThisIsTNA) September 27, 2025
WATCH #TNAVictoryRoad on TNA+: https://t.co/QtSUgdUYkS
Use code VICTORY25 for one free month of TNA+: https://t.co/d4BBN0TwN2 pic.twitter.com/ph0JJF9ZUz
A new Knockouts World Champion will be crowned as Léi Yǐng Lee and NXT’s Kelani Jordan collide with Indi Hartwell as Special Guest Referee! Jordan locks in a single-leg Boston Crab. Lee fights free and picks her off the top with a Hurricanrana. Jordan delivers a series of strikes but Lee fires back. Lee hits a Blue Thunder Bomb but it’s not enough to keep Jordan down. The fight spills to the outside where Lee hits a thudding mid-air powerbomb. Back in the ring, Jordan soars with a top rope Frog Splash for another near fall. Jordan inadvertently takes out Hartwell. Lee has Jordan beat following a spin kick but Hartwell is late to make the count. Jordan recovers and connects with One of a King to become the new Knockouts World Champion.
Winner: Kelani Jordan via Pinfall to become the new TNA Knockouts World Champion.
After the match, TNA President Carlos Silva awards the Knockouts World Championship to Kelani Jordan, and she is congratulated by Léi Yǐng Lee and Ash By Elegance.
